The Ford Foundation is an independent, nonprofit, nongovernmental organization that is a resource for innovative people and institutions. The foundation s goals are to: strengthen democratic values, reduce poverty and injustice, promote international cooperation and advance human achievement. The Ford Foundation was founded in 1936 and expanded in 1950 to become a national and international foundation. It encourages initiatives to promote collaboration among the nonprofit, government and business sectors, and to ensure participation by men and women from diverse communities and at all levels of society. The trustees of the foundation set policy and delegate authority to the president and senior staff for the foundation s grantmaking and operations. Program officers in the United States, Africa, the Middle East, Asia, Latin America and Russia explore opportunities to pursue the foundation s goals, formulate strategies and recommend proposals for funding. The foundation is based in New York, N.Y.

The Epilepsy Foundation of Metropolitan New York is a non-profit social service organization and dedicated to improving the quality life of people with epilepsy and their families. Our program services are available to residents of New York City and Westchester County. Services are made possible through contractual agreements. All informational services are provided free of charge. Some programs have admissions criteria.

The New York City Alliance Against Sexual Assault is a leading voice for preventing sexual violence and supporting survivors. We are an advocacy organization for rape crisis centers and survivors citywide, fighting to make our communities safer. Our cutting-edge programs in prevention, training and establishing standards to assist survivors are models to end sexual violence.

The Gay, Lesbian and Straight Education Network, also known as GLSEN, is one of the leading provides of sexual orientation programs in the United States. Established in 1990, the organization focuses on issues concerning gender identity and expression. It assists schools in prohibiting bullying, harassment and biased behavior with gays, lesbians and transgender individuals. The Gay, Lesbian and Straight Education Network s student organizing department provides support and technical assistance for more than 4,000 registered student clubs. In addition, the organization s public policy department advocates for legislative changes. It receives support from a variety of institutions, including private foundations, corporations and corporate entities.
